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K filing by Federal Agricultural Mortgage Corporation (Farmer Mac) reports on events occurring on August 14, 2025. The registrant is a federally chartered instrumentality of the United States. The filing primarily addresses executive leadership changes and associated compensatory arrangements.

Material Changes
The primary material change reported is the announced retirement of Stephen P. Mullery, Executive Vice President - General Counsel and Secretary. Key details include:
- Retirement Date: April 3, 2026.
- Succession: Geraldine Hayhurst is expected to assume the role of Executive Vice President - Chief Legal Officer and Secretary on September 8, 2025.
- Transition Role: Mr. Mullery will serve as a senior advisor to Ms. Hayhurst until his retirement.
Compensatory Arrangements and Outlook
Under a Transition Agreement approved by the Board of Directors, Mr. Mullery will receive the following compensation contingent on his continued employment and execution of a Separation Agreement:
- Continued Compensation: Salary and benefits as previously in effect until the Retirement Date.
- Short-Term Incentive: Eligibility for a discretionary cash bonus for 2025 performance.
- Lump Sum Payment: $500,000 plus any excess of his 2025 target cash bonus over the actual bonus paid.
- Equity Award: Time-vested Restricted Stock Units (RSUs) with a targeted value of $200,000, fully vesting on May 2, 2026.
- Existing Awards: Departure qualifies as "Retirement" for outstanding stock appreciation rights and restricted stock units.
A press release regarding these changes was issued on August 18, 2025.
